those with dyno don headers please help

Installing my dyno don headers I got the driver side in fine now I'm stuck on the passenger side. The header is hitting a tube which appears to be going to the heater core, and I can't seem to move it anywhere where it is not in the way, if anyone has any suggestions they would greatly be appreciated. Re: those with dyno don headers please help

I had that problem with a set of hooker 2055's. Thats a steel coolant line that goes to heater core. I simply removed the 2 screws that hold it in place then mocked the header up and moved the coolant line till it cleared and drilled a new hole for the screw.

Re: those with dyno don headers please help

i had the same issue with my hookers. i jacked the car up and slid the header on from underneath, as well as unbolting the bracket that holds the steel coolant line and pushing it as close to the fender as it could go. it took some fanagaling but its easier than trying from the top.

Re: those with dyno don headers please help

I forgot to mention that i cut the tab off the steel line and only used the front mounting screw. That allowed the steel line to go under the ac box and then the header cleared fine.
